Key Skills to Look For
Technical skills
Look for proficiency in ERP systems such as SAP or Oracle, as well as strong data analysis abilities using Excel, SQL, or Power BI. Knowledge of supply chain optimization techniques and forecasting tools is also essential.
Diverse portfolio elements
Review prior experience in logistics, procurement, and inventory management across industries like manufacturing, retail, and FMCG to assess versatility.
Soft skills
Emphasize analytical thinking, communication, teamwork, and adaptability to changing supply chain conditions.
Relevant sector experience
Experience in Egypt’s key sectors such as manufacturing, import-export, and e-commerce logistics adds significant value.
Screening & Interviewing Process
Portfolio evaluation criteria
Assess analytical reports, process improvement case studies, and logistics optimization outcomes. Look for measurable impact and strategic thinking.
Recommended interview formats
Combine video and in-person interviews to evaluate both technical skills and communication style. Focus on problem-solving and project management capabilities.
Sample interview questions for Supply Chain Analyst
- How do you approach identifying inefficiencies in a supply chain?
- What tools and metrics do you use to forecast demand accurately?
- Describe a time you improved a process that reduced costs or lead time.
Technical tests or paid trial projects
Offer a short data analysis or scenario-based task to evaluate accuracy and strategic insight.
Importance of references
Request references from local or regional clients who can speak to the candidate’s performance and reliability.
Factors for Successful Collaboration
Writing clear, specific project briefs
Define deliverables, expectations, and milestones early to ensure mutual understanding.
Suggest collaboration tools
Use tools like Trello or Asana for task tracking, Google Drive for document sharing, and Slack for daily communication.
Define revision processes
Establish structured feedback cycles with set review dates to maintain progress and quality.
Outline contract essentials
Include scope, timelines, payment terms, confidentiality, and IP rights in every agreement.
Emphasize regular progress check-ins
Schedule weekly updates to ensure alignment and transparency throughout the project.
Challenges to Watch Out For
Scope creep
Control changes through documented approvals and transparent communication.
Intellectual property safeguards
Ensure signed agreements clearly transfer ownership of deliverables and data models.
Payment and contract security
Use secure payment methods such as escrow or invoicing through verified systems.
Time zone differences
Although Giza shares time zones with many regional clients, plan buffer times for international coordination.
